What companies run services between El Paso, TX, USA and Missouri, USA?

American Airlines, United Airlines, and Delta fly from El Paso International Airport (ELP) to Springfield-Branson National Airport (SGF) hourly. Alternatively, Omnibus Express operates a bus from El Paso to 2745 Southwest Blvd - Kansas City once daily. Tickets cost $140–190 and the journey takes 18h 8m.
